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Поиск и подстановка данных - Мир MS Excel

Старая форма входа
  • Страница 1 из 1
  • 1
Модератор форума: китин, _Boroda_  
Мир MS Excel » Вопросы и решения » Вопросы по VBA » Поиск и подстановка данных (Макросы/Sub)
Поиск и подстановка данных
RusMebel Дата: Вторник, 06.08.2019, 14:14 | Сообщение № 1
Группа: Пользователи
Ранг: Прохожий
Сообщений: 3
Репутация: 0 ±
Замечаний: 0% ±

Excel 2007
Доброго дня, уважаемые форумчане. Искал решение своего вопроса на форуме, но к сожалению не могу приладить к своему файлу.
Суть вопроса в следующем.
Есть файл, в нем лист с базой посетителей, и лист с действиями с этими клиентами. Нужен макрос для поиска уникальных совпадений, это либо по порядковому номеру (столбец А) либо по ФИО.
В листе действия в последние 2 столбца вносятся изменения, хотелось бы чтобы эти изменения переносились в лист База.
Заранее спасибо за участие.
К сообщению приложен файл: __.xlsm (13.7 Kb)


Всем добра!
 
Ответить
СообщениеДоброго дня, уважаемые форумчане. Искал решение своего вопроса на форуме, но к сожалению не могу приладить к своему файлу.
Суть вопроса в следующем.
Есть файл, в нем лист с базой посетителей, и лист с действиями с этими клиентами. Нужен макрос для поиска уникальных совпадений, это либо по порядковому номеру (столбец А) либо по ФИО.
В листе действия в последние 2 столбца вносятся изменения, хотелось бы чтобы эти изменения переносились в лист База.
Заранее спасибо за участие.

Автор - RusMebel
Дата добавления - 06.08.2019 в 14:14
RusMebel Дата: Среда, 07.08.2019, 10:21 | Сообщение № 2
Группа: Пользователи
Ранг: Прохожий
Сообщений: 3
Репутация: 0 ±
Замечаний: 0% ±

Excel 2007
Друзья, я понимаю, что для экспертов этого сайта, моя тема яйца выеденного не стоит, прошу хотя бы подсказать, где можно посмотреть аналогичный пример?


Всем добра!
 
Ответить
СообщениеДрузья, я понимаю, что для экспертов этого сайта, моя тема яйца выеденного не стоит, прошу хотя бы подсказать, где можно посмотреть аналогичный пример?

Автор - RusMebel
Дата добавления - 07.08.2019 в 10:21
pechkin Дата: Среда, 07.08.2019, 12:42 | Сообщение № 3
Группа: Проверенные
Ранг: Обитатель
Сообщений: 329
Репутация: 49 ±
Замечаний: 0% ±

2003
Здравствуйте! Проверяйте...[vba]
Код
Sub В_БАЗУ()
Dim aLastRow As Long, bLastRow As Long
With Sheets("База")
aLastRow = Cells(Rows.Count, 1).End(xlUp).Row
bLastRow = .Cells(Rows.Count, 1).End(xlUp).Row
For i = 2 To aLastRow
For ii = 2 To bLastRow
If Cells(i, 1).Value = .Cells(ii, 1).Value And .Cells(ii, 1) <> "" Then
.Cells(ii, 13).Resize(, 2).Value = Cells(i, 9).Resize(, 2).Value
End If
Next
Next
End With
MsgBox ("Готово!")
End Sub
[/vba]
К сообщению приложен файл: 0841260.xls (49.0 Kb)
 
Ответить
СообщениеЗдравствуйте! Проверяйте...[vba]
Код
Sub В_БАЗУ()
Dim aLastRow As Long, bLastRow As Long
With Sheets("База")
aLastRow = Cells(Rows.Count, 1).End(xlUp).Row
bLastRow = .Cells(Rows.Count, 1).End(xlUp).Row
For i = 2 To aLastRow
For ii = 2 To bLastRow
If Cells(i, 1).Value = .Cells(ii, 1).Value And .Cells(ii, 1) <> "" Then
.Cells(ii, 13).Resize(, 2).Value = Cells(i, 9).Resize(, 2).Value
End If
Next
Next
End With
MsgBox ("Готово!")
End Sub
[/vba]

Автор - pechkin
Дата добавления - 07.08.2019 в 12:42
RusMebel Дата: Среда, 07.08.2019, 12:48 | Сообщение № 4
Группа: Пользователи
Ранг: Прохожий
Сообщений: 3
Репутация: 0 ±
Замечаний: 0% ±

Excel 2007
pechkin, Спасибо огромное! То что нужно.


Всем добра!
 
Ответить
Сообщениеpechkin, Спасибо огромное! То что нужно.

Автор - RusMebel
Дата добавления - 07.08.2019 в 12:48
Мир MS Excel » Вопросы и решения » Вопросы по VBA » Поиск и подстановка данных (Макросы/Sub)
  • Страница 1 из 1
  • 1
Поиск:

Яндекс.Метрика Яндекс цитирования
© 2010-2024 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!